Cucumber Chips

This Keto Cucumber Chips recipe makes two servings. One serving has 3g net carbs.

Store leftover Keto Cucumber Chips in an airtight container in the pantry for up to 1 week.

Cucumber Chips Ingredients

Raw cucumber chips on a dehydrator tray
Dehydrated Cucumber Chips Ingredients
  • 1 large Cucumber – English/Continental/Telegraph (depending on where you live in the world)
  • 1 tablespoon of Olive Oil
  • ¼ teaspoon of Salt
  • ¼ teaspoon of Paprika

How to Make Cucumber Chips In A Food Dehydrator

A Cucumber Chip with creamy dip on the end being held to the camera
How to make Cucumber Chips in a food dehydrator.
  1. Thinly slice the cucumber using a mandolin slicer. Be careful not to cut your fingers. About 2-3mm thick.
  2. Place the slices into a bowl and add the remaining ingredients. Mix well.
  3. Place the cucumber into the baskets of your dehydrator, leaving gaps between them to let the air flow through.
  4. Dehydrate on high for 6-8 hours until the cucumber is completely dried and crispy.
  5. Enjoy your snack with some Keto Feta Cheese Dip.
